On Friday, May 2, former Waubonsie Valley High School standout Tyler Patton’s current college team, the Aurora Spartans, won 13-3 in their NCAA Division III baseball game against the Wabash Little Giants.

The game took place at Jim Schmid Field at Stuart Complex. This was their first matchup against the Little Giants this season.
